This year’s annual ‘Fishing Experience’ will be held on Saturday, May 19, 2018 at the Old Fishing Hole Park located on Frager Road, south of West Meeker Street (map below).

This FREE event is sponsored by the Rotary Club of Kent and Kent Parks, and is open to children ages 4 to 14.

It will run from 7:30 a.m. – Noon.

This non-competitive event focuses on fishing techniques, safety around water and environmental stewardship.

Each participant will be partnered with an experienced guide for a fishing lesson, as well as an opportunity to catch a trout.

All fishing equipment will be provided for the participants – PLEASE DO NOT BRING YOUR OWN GEAR.

Space is limited so pre-registration is required by or before Wednesday, May 17.
